IDEX opens office in the Silicon Valley area

Oslo, Norway, 21 October 2013: IDEX opens a California office in the Silicon Valley area. The office will be headed by Thar Casey, President of IDEX’s US subsidiary IDEX America Inc. Mr. Casey was previously CEO of PicoField Technologies, Inc.

On 23 September 2013 IDEX acquired technology and hired staff from PicoField Technologies, Inc.

“The Silicon Valley office gives us a presence right at the centre hotspot in a very important region for information technology and our business,” said Dr. Hemant Mardia, CEO of IDEX. “This is a significant step in achieving a global presence for IDEX in order to exploit the rapidly increasing demand for fingerprint biometrics in the consumer market, and especially for low-cost swipe and touch sensors for mobile devices,” he added.

The office in Silicon Valley will be expanded to handle demand from customers and partners in line with business development.

“Silicon Valley is ground zero for innovation in technology today. We are excited to join this vibrant community by bringing our own experience, IP portfolio and future products to the Valley,” said Thar Casey, President of IDEX America. “Our goal is to make a strong presence in the Valley by partnering with the leaders in the ecosystem that drives advances in mobile devices.”

Apple’s release of its Touch ID technology in the iPhone 5S last month has put fingerprint technology squarely in the mobile technology spotlight, and the market is expected to show rapid growth.

“It is important to note that smartphone vendors other than Apple hold over 85 per cent of the market, and IDEX is one of three principal suppliers positioned to serve the mass market for increased authentication both on smartphones and other consumer devices. A footprint in Silicon Valley is very important to IDEX, and I am thrilled by the prospects from this jump-start of our presence in the USA, leveraging existing networks resulting from the PicoField agreement together with supporting strategic relationships resulting from IDEX reputation for industry leading fingerprint sensor IP and technology,” said Dr. Mardia.

About IDEX
IDEX ASA specialises in fingerprint imaging and recognition technology. IDEX’s vision is to ensure individuals a safe, secure, and user-friendly use of personal ID. IDEX has developed the award-winning SmartFinger® technology platform based on the Company’s core intellectual property, including the patented fingerprint imaging principle, sensing scheme and chip design. Combined with core software solutions for imaging and authentication, the SmartFinger technology enables on-device enrollment, template storage and verification within the very same module. SmartFinger solutions can be seamlessly integrated into a variety of embedded applications such as mobile phones, one-time password devices, Smartcards, payment and ID cards, payment terminals, access control devices and biometric security and login tokens.

IDEX ASA (ticker IDEX) is a Norwegian public company listed at the Oslo Axess marketplace on the Oslo Børs (Oslo stock exchange). For more information, please visit www.idexbiometrics.com or contact IDEX at mailbox@idexbiometrics.com
